DCCEEW_Geospatial - Interim Biogeographic Regionalisation for Australia (IBRA) Version 6.1 (Regions)
Interim Biogeographic Regionalisation for Australia (IBRA) version 6.1 represents a landscape based approach to classifying the land surface of Australia. 85 biogeographic regions and 405 sub regions have been delineated, each reflecting a unifying set of major environmental influences which shape the occurrence of flora and fauna and their interaction with the physical environment across Australia.The IBRA Version 6.1 data consists of two datasets. IBRA bioregions, which is a larger scale regional classification of homogenous ecosystems, and sub regions, which are more localised.IBRA Version 6.1 is the result of refinement of the IBRA Version 5.1 and version 6.0 boundaries due to better data availability amongst some states and territories and also based on alterations by the states/territories along the state borders. The refined boundaries were jointly defined by the Commonwealth, State and Territory nature and conservation agencies. Those jurisdictions to refine their data in this version of IBRA include New South Wales, Queensland, Victoria and Western Australia. There are 53 newly named sub regions and 5 have been renamed from version 5.1. Whilst there has been a refinement of sub-regional and associated bioregional boundaries in Qld, Vic and western NSW, the new sub-regions are found principally in eastern NSW. In WA changes relate to moving the western boundary of Yalgoo bioregion to the coast, truncating the northern portion of the Geraldton Sandplains bioregion.Nominal attributes that make up IBRA are: climate, lithology/geology, landform, vegetation, flora and fauna, and landuse. The use of these attributes varies across the jurisdictions and for further information individual jurisdictions should be contacted.

Interim Biogeographic Regionalisation for Australia (IBRA), Version 7 (Regions)

Interim Biogeographic Regionalisation for Australia (IBRA) version 7.0 represents a landscape based approach to classifying the land surface of Australia. 89 biogeographic regions and 419 sub regions have been delineated, each reflecting a unifying set of major environmental influences which shape the occurrence of flora and fauna and their interaction with the physical environment across Australia and its external territories (excluding Antarctica). IBRA Version 7.0 data consists of two datasets. IBRA bioregions, which is a larger scale regional classification of homogenous ecosystems, and sub regions, which are more localised. IBRA Version 7.0 is the result of both significant changes to certain IBRA 6.1 boundaries, plus refinement of other boundaries due to better data availability amongst some states and territories, and alterations by the states/territories along state borders. The updated boundaries were jointly defined by the Commonwealth, State and Territory nature and conservation agencies. In this respect refinements were carried out to all mainland jurisdictions with significant changes in Queensland and South Australia. In addition the dataset was also updated to more closely conform to the Geoscience Australia 1:100K State borders, and a standard coding/naming convention introduced (for both regions and sub-regions) resulting in differences to both names and codes used in earlier IBRA Versions. Various sources were used to delineate islands - these included the GA100K Admin layer plus the Australian Maritime Boundaries dataset, a Coral Sea dataset (held in ERIN) and the GA Commonwealth Fisheries 2006 dataset.
